Jan D. Lüttringhaus (* 1980 ) is a German legal scholar .

Life

He studied law at the universities of Passau , Aix-en-Provence (Maîtrise en droit), Bonn and at the Columbia Law School New York ( LL.M. ) (2006 first state examination in law ; 2009 doctorate at the University of Cologne with Heinz- Peter Mansel ; 2011 Second State Examination in Law; 2017 Habilitation at the University of Hamburg with Jürgen Basedow ). From 2006 to 2009 he was a research assistant and from 2011 to 2018 research consultant at the Max Planck Institute for Comparative and International Private Law and a lecturer at the University of Hamburg. He represented chairs in Münster and Hamburg. Since 2019 he has been teaching as a university professor for civil law and insurance law at the Law Faculty of the University of Hanover .

His main research interests are civil law; international private and procedural law; Civil procedural law; Business law, in particular insurance law and comparative law.
